HCM City Customs: Suggestions for removing difficulties in specialized inspection for enterprises

VCN – From the suggestions by Customs authorities, the Ministry of Construction has issued a document guiding state inspection on quality for a list of products and construction materials. However, HCM City Construction Department has not performed this, causing difficulties for import enterprises. HCM City Customs Department has sent a document to the People’s Committee of HCM City to provide suggestions on this issue.

According to HCM City Customs Department, at border gates, enterprises have faced difficulties relating to state inspection on quality for the list of products and construction materials attached to Circular No.19/2014/TT-BXD dated December 31, 2019.

Pursuant to Point 2, Article 20, Decree No.132/2008/NĐ-CP dated December 31, 2008 amending and supplementing Decree No. 74/2018/ND-CP dated May 15, 2018 of the Government detailing the implementation of a number of articles of the Law on Product and Goods Quality, stipulates: “The inspection agency on local product and goods quality is a specialized agency under the People's Committee of the province or city directly under the control of the Government performing the function of state management of product and goods quality in the locality in charge of the inspection of product quality in the management area in accordance with the regulations of the line Ministries.”

Every day, there is a huge amount of construction materials imported for enterprises in ​​​​Ho Chi Minh City.

According to the provisions of the law on customs, for goods imported for businesses, enterprises can choose the most convenient place to carry out customs procedures.

Therefore, for businesses that do not have a business address in Ho Chi Minh City, if they import goods to ports in the city, the HCM City Customs Department will still carry out customs procedures following regulations. However, according to the instructions in Official Dispatch No. 4945/BXD-KHCN dated October 12, 2020 of the Ministry of Construction, HCM City Construction Department does not accept to carry out state inspection of quality for businesses without a registered address in the locality and requests these enterprises to go to the construction department of the province or city where they registered to carry out procedures.

This leads to longer processing time, especially in cities where the inspection has not been carried out (Hanoi, Da Nang) resulting in congestion of imported goods at HCM City ports and businesses also changing to local customs departments to carry out customs procedures where the Department of Construction receives specialized inspection.

Regarding this problem, HCM City Customs Department reported and the General Department of Vietnam Customs issued a document to petition the Ministry of Construction. On September 16, 2021, the Ministry of Construction issued Official Letter No. 3772/BXD-VLXD in reply to the letter stating: “…the state inspection agency for the quality of imported building materials and products is the construction departments of the provinces and cities in the locality where the importer registers his/her business or the locality where the goods are imported.” However, this issue has not yet been implemented by the HCM City Construction Department.

In order to support businesses in specialized inspection, reducing time and costs as well as storage costs, especially in the current period when the Government and Ho Chi Minh City People's Committee are implementing a plan to support businesses to recover after the Covid-19 pandemic, HCM City Customs Department proposed HCM City People's Committee to direct and create conditions for HCM City Construction Department to carry out specialized inspection for imported construction materials following Official Letter No. 3772/BXD-VLXD dated September 16, 2021.

To facilitate businesses, the General Department of Vietnam Customs proposed, the order of state inspection of the quality of products and goods as imported construction materials: “the importer submits the registration for state inspection of quality, quantity of products and goods being construction materials, certified by the inspection agency for the customs authority to be allowed to clear the goods”.

However, the Ministry of Construction said that, currently, the order and procedures for state inspection of imported goods quality are prescribed in Decree No. 74/2018/ND-CP dated May 15, 2018 of the Government. Therefore, the permission to apply is different from the provisions in the Decree within the authority of the Government. The Ministry of Construction will study and propose the above opinion to the authority to chair the drafting of the Decree amending, supplementing or replacing Decree No. 74/2018/ND-CP dated May 15, 2018 of the Government.

According to the Ministry of Construction, in order to shorten customs clearance time and reduce congestion at the border gate, the General Department of Vietnam Customs can guide importers to carry out procedures for exemption from quality inspection of imported goods belonging to group 2 if it satisfies the conditions specified in Decree No. 154/2018/ND-CP dated November 9, 2013 of the Government to be cleared.
